目录
- 前言
- 1. 清除 npm 缓存:
- 2. 删除node_modules目录:
- 3. 重新安装依赖:
- 4. 检查项目配置文件:
- 5. 更新 Vue CLI:
- 6. 使用 Yarn:
- 7. 清除临时文件:
- 8. 升级 Node.js:
- 9. 检查错误信息:
- 补充:Cannot find module 'vue-loader/lib/plugin'
- 总结
前言
如果你在运行 Vue 项目时遇到了与cache-loader相关的错误,通常可以通过以下步骤解决:
1. 清除 npm 缓存:
运行以下命令清除 npm 缓存:
npm cache clean –force
2. 删除node_modules目录:
rm -rf node_modules
或者在 Windows 上使用:
rmdir /s /q node_modules
3. 重新安装依赖:
npm install
4. 检查项目配置文件:
检查项目的配置文件(如vue.config.js或webpack.config.js)是否正确配置了 loaders。确保没有配置错误或不匹配的 loader。
5. 更新 Vue CLI:
确保你的 Vue CLI 是最新版本。你可以使用以下命令更新:
npm install -g @vue/cli
6. 使用 Yarn:
如果你是使用 npm,尝试使用 Yarn 来管理依赖。首先,确保你已经安装了 Yarn。然后运行以下命令:
yarn install
7. 清除临时文件:
有时,构建过程中的临时文件可能导致问题。尝试清除dist目录(或你的构建输出目录)以及任何其他临时文件。
8. 升级 Node.js:
确保你的 Node.js 版本是最新的。你可以在命令行中运行以下命令来检查:
node -v
如果版本过旧,建议更新到最新的 LTS 版本。
9. 检查错误信息:
仔细检查错误信息,查找与cache-loader相关的详细错误。这可能会提供更多关于问题的线索。
如果问题仍然存在,请提供更详细的错误信息,以便更好地帮助你解决问题。
相关问题
补充:Cannot find module 'vue-loader/lib/plugin'
这个错误通常是由于缺少vue-loader插件导致的。可以尝试通过以下步骤解决该问题:
-
确保你已经安装了vue-loader,如果没有,可以执行以下命令进行安装:
npm install vue-loader –save-dev
-
如果你已经安装了vue-loader,那么可能是因为你的webpack.config.js配置文件中没有正确引用vue-loader插件。在plugins数组中添加以下代码:
const VueLoaderPlugin = require(\’vue-loader/lib/plugin\’)
module.exports = {
// … 其他配置 …
plugins: [
// 请确保引入了 VueLoaderPlugin
new VueLoaderPlugin()
]
}如果你使用的是vue-cli,那么这个插件应该已经默认安装并配置好了,你只需要检查是否存在vue-loader插件即可。
总结
到此这篇关于vue运行报错cache-loader解决的文章就介绍到这了,更多相关vue运行报错cache-loader内容请搜索悠久资源网以前的文章或继续浏览下面的相关文章希望大家以后多多支持悠久资源网!
您可能感兴趣的文章:
- vue-cli创建项目时由esLint校验导致报错或警告的问题及解决
- vue 3.0使用element-plus按需导入方法以及报错解决
- vue3项目中配置sass,vite报错Undefinedmixin问题
- vue使用@include或@mixin报错的问题及解决
- 解决vue创建项目使用vue-router和vuex报错Object(…)isnotafunction